Just in case anyone cares, you can quite easily make your aliens look more alien-like if you have PS 7.0 or higher (6 might have it). Use the 'liquify' filter and then use the bulge effect over eyes etc. This is very effective. then use like a color overlay using the hue/saturation bars, to make your person different colours. I've made some of my teachers look very much like Admiral Ackbar using these techniques!
